West Virginia Code § 38-16-505

Plaintiff's costs

(a) The court shall award the plaintiff the costs of bringing the action if:
(1) The plaintiff prevails; and
(2) The court finds that the defendant, at the time the defendant caused the recorded
document to be recorded or filed, knew or should have known that the recorded document is
fraudulent.
(b) For purposes of this section, the costs of bringing the action include all court costs,
attorney's fees, and related expenses of bringing the action, including investigative
expenses.
